1. Master Mobile-First Design & Lightning-Fast Performance

Google predominantly uses mobile-first indexing, meaning your mobile site is the primary version considered for ranking. Couple this with Pakistan’s high mobile internet usage, and the message is clear: mobile responsiveness and speed are non-negotiable.

Optimize for the Small Screen First:

  • Responsive Layouts: Ensure your website seamlessly adapts to all screen sizes, from smartphones to tablets and desktops. This is crucial for user experience (UX) and search engine crawlability.
  • Touch-Friendly Elements: Buttons and links should be easily tappable without frustration.
  • Legible Fonts: Text must be readable on smaller screens without requiring zooming.

Boost Your Website Speed Optimization:

Slow websites kill conversions and tank your SEO. Users in Pakistan, like anywhere else, expect instant gratification. Focus on these core web vitals for a fast-loading website:

  • Image Optimization: Compress images without sacrificing quality. Use modern formats like WebP.
  • Leverage Browser Caching: Store parts of your website on visitors’ browsers for faster return visits.
  • Minimize Code: Clean up unnecessary CSS, JavaScript, and HTML.

2. Intuitive User Experience (UX) & Clean Site Architecture

A well-structured website guides users effortlessly and helps search engines understand your content hierarchy. This is where brilliant UI design meets robust technical SEO.

Seamless Navigation:

Your website’s navigation should be clear, concise, and logical. Think of it as a roadmap for both users and search engine bots.

  • Clear Menus: Use simple, descriptive labels for menu items.
  • Breadcrumbs: Implement breadcrumbs to show users (and search engines) where they are on your site.
  • Internal Linking Strategy: Strategically link related pages together. This distributes “link juice,” improves crawlability, and encourages users to explore more of your site.

Logical Site Structure:

Organize your content in a clear, hierarchical manner, typically starting from your homepage to broad categories, then specific subcategories and individual pages.

  • Flat Architecture: Aim for a “flat” structure where important pages are only a few clicks from the homepage.
  • XML Sitemaps: Submit an XML sitemap to Google Search Console. This helps search engines discover and index all your important pages.
  • Robots.txt: Use a robots.txt file to guide search engine crawlers, telling them which parts of your site they should or shouldn’t access.

3. Strategic Keyword Integration & Semantic SEO for Pakistan

It’s not just about stuffing keywords; it’s about understanding user intent and using related phrases to build comprehensive content that ranks for a variety of relevant searches.

Perform Local Keyword Research Pakistan:

Identify what your target audience in Pakistan is actually searching for. This includes:

  • Head Terms: Broad keywords (e.g., “web design Pakistan”).
  • Long-Tail Keywords: More specific phrases (e.g., “affordable SEO friendly web design services Lahore”).
  • Geo-Specific Keywords: Including city or region names (e.g., “best SEO company Karachi”).
  • LSI Keywords (Latent Semantic Indexing): These are semantically related terms that Google uses to understand the context of your content (e.g., for “car,” LSI keywords might include “vehicle,” “automobile,” “driving,” “engine”).

On-Page SEO Best Practices:

Weave your researched keywords naturally into key areas of your website design:

  • Title Tags & Meta Descriptions: Craft compelling, keyword-rich titles and meta descriptions for every page to improve click-through rates.
  • Header Tags (H1, H2, H3): Structure your content with relevant keywords in your headings to improve readability and tell search engines what your content is about.
  • High-Quality Content: Produce valuable, informative, and engaging content that genuinely answers user queries. This is the cornerstone of semantic SEO.
  • Image Alt Text: Describe images using relevant keywords. This helps visually impaired users and search engines understand your images.

4. Harnessing Schema Markup & Local SEO Pakistan

To stand out in local search results and provide rich information to Google, structured data is your ally.

Implement Schema Markup:

Schema markup (structured data) helps search engines understand the context of your content, leading to rich snippets in search results (e.g., star ratings, product prices, event dates).

  • Local Business Schema: Essential for Pakistani businesses to highlight address, phone number, opening hours, and business type.
  • Product Schema: For e-commerce sites, display prices, availability, and reviews directly in search results.
  • Article/Blog Post Schema: Helps search engines understand your blog content.

5. Website Security (HTTPS) & Robust Back-End

Google prioritizes secure websites, and so do your users. An HTTPS connection is no longer optional.

  • SSL Certificate: Ensure your website has an SSL certificate, encrypting data between your server and the user’s browser. This displays “HTTPS” in the URL and a padlock icon, building trust and offering a minor ranking boost.
